> > I've had a little bit of time to work on this again. However, I am unfamiliar with the build process for your dependencies (specifically the build.sh script). Every time I try to build the dependencies using build.sh I get the following error during the build of gettext:
> >
> > mv: rename /Users/jclyons/adium/Dependencies/source/gettext/gettext-runtime/config.h to /Users/jclyons/adium/Dependencies/source/gettext/gettext-runtime/config-x86_64.h: No such file or directory
> >
> > This is after the "configure" phase of the build script, so there should be a config.h file, unless something is going wrong...but it doesn't look like there are any verbose debugging flags for build.sh, so I can't tell.
>
> Try taking a look at error.log and build.log in the Dependencies directory. My guess is that the configure phase is failing somehow; the verbose debugging goes to the *.log files, so hopefully that will be enlightening either to you or to someone on the list.
